A frugal couple shared a cheap kitchen remodel with marble vinyl-they only spent more than £100. Rachel and Max used IKEA and hardware store specials to make the space feel more fashionable and more in line with their style.

Their ultimate goal is to knock into the restaurant space and make the area an open plan. At the same time, they want to use some fresh kitchen ideas to update things and make the core of their home happier.

Before the renovation, the kitchen had plain brown cabinets and black countertops. But they want to get a more modern and monochromatic feel. In accepting the latest deal, Rachel said: "During the lockdown, when we were looking for a house, we had much more time on hand."

“So I spent a few hours saving photos of my favorite ideas on Instagram and Pinterest and creating a mood board for each room,” she said. Their first port of call was B&Q, where they took paint for the cabinets.

To make things feel more special, they painted the hardware gold with some cheap spray paint from Amazon. The eye-catching thing is the lovely marble effect film. Rachel and Max used it on the countertop, bringing texture and luxury.

The marble-effect vinyl packaging makes a huge difference, as does the fresh paint. The product they use is DC-Fix Gloss Grey Marble effect self-adhesive film, B&Q price of 5 pounds-if your renovation budget is limited, this is the perfect choice.

The two used marble vinyl to complete the entire budget kitchen renovation by purchasing items from B&Q, IKEA and Facebook Marketplace. On the other side of the kitchen, they placed new open shelves with IKEA storage jars and artificial indoor plants.

Jars with wooden lids are a bargain at Poundland. These are great storage solutions for small spaces because they can make the most of the vertical space you have.

We like the two-tone appearance of the cream and dark navy paint. The marble-effect countertops and Aldi cooking utensils that look like Le Creuset definitely enhance the entire space.

So, will they do something different next time? They said they would remove the cabinet doors to make painting easier.
